PHARMACY BENEFIT MANAGER LICENSURE AND REGULATION ACT (EXCERPT) Act 11 of 2022 550.829 Prohibited conduct. Sec. 19.

(1)A pharmacy benefit manager shall not discriminate against a nonaffiliated pharmacy that is a retail pharmacy.
(2)A pharmacy benefit manager shall not impose limits, including quantity limits or refill frequency limits, on an enrollee's access to retail prescription drugs that differ based solely on whether the pharmacy benefit manager has an ownership interest in a pharmacy or the pharmacy has an ownership interest in the pharmacy benefit manager.
